Fall Wedding Outfit Ideas: Chic Autumn Style for Brides & Guests

Fall weddings offer a unique canvas for personal style, blending the vibrant energy of the season with the formal elegance of the occasion. As the temperature drops, the opportunity to layer textures and incorporate rich, seasonal colors becomes central to looking polished without sacrificing comfort. The key to navigating these events lies in understanding how to adapt current trends to the specific dress code, ensuring your outfit feels both intentional and at ease.

Decoding the Autumn Wedding Dress Code

Before diving into specific pieces, it is essential to interpret the invitation details carefully. A garden ceremony might call for something lighter, while a vineyard reception allows for heavier fabrics and more structured silhouettes. When in doubt, leaning slightly overdressed is always a safer bet than being underdressed, as it demonstrates respect for the couple and the effort they put into their special day.

Consider the venue and time of day. An afternoon barn gathering invites a different energy than an evening rooftop ceremony. The goal is to align your aesthetic with the atmosphere, using the season as your guide rather than simply reaching for the nearest cozy sweater.

Color Palettes That Complement the Season

Autumn provides a naturally sophisticated backdrop for wedding attire. Instead of bright summer hues, focus on a curated selection of deep, moody tones that photograph beautifully. These colors not only flatter a wide range of skin tones but also integrate seamlessly with the fall landscape.

Burgundy and Merlot: These rich reds offer depth and drama without being overly harsh.

Olive and Forest Green: Perfect for those who want to blend classic elegance with an earthy, grounded feel.

Burnt Orange and Rust: Ideal for adding a warm, fiery pop that captures the essence of the season.

Deep Plum and Eggplant: A luxurious and regal choice that stands out in photos.

Camel and Chocolates: Neutrals that are endlessly chic and easy to accessorize.

Strategic Layering for Comfort and Style

Mastering the art of layering is the single most important skill for a fall wedding outfit. It allows you to adapt to shifting temperatures from the ceremony outdoors to the reception indoors. The trick is to ensure that your layers contribute to the overall look rather than just providing warmth.

Start with a foundation that fits well, whether that is a bodycon dress or a tailored trouser. Then, build upon it with items like structured blazers, cropped leather jackets, or elegant capes. This approach ensures you remain comfortable without compromising your polished appearance.

Essential Outerwear and Accessories

The right outerwear can elevate an entire ensemble, turning a simple dress into a complete autumn look. A tailored wool coat or a faux leather moto jacket can add instant sophistication. For footwear, ankle boots are a versatile choice, providing both style and stability for outdoor venues.

Scarves: A silk scarf tied at the neck or draped over the shoulders adds a touch of texture.

Hats: A wide-brimmed felt hat is perfect for daytime events, while a sleek beanley works for evening affairs.

Handbags: Opt for a structured crossbody or a clutch in a luxe material like patent leather.

Many modern weddings move between spaces, such as a garden ceremony and a historic library reception. Your outfit needs to be flexible enough to handle this transition without requiring a complete change. Selecting pieces that are inherently dressy but adaptable is the solution.

For example, a jumpsuit in a heavy crepe fabric can look incredibly chic with statement earrings for the ceremony, and then simply by swapping the shoes to a pair of sleek boots and throwing on a trench coat, it transforms into an effortlessly cool evening look. This minimizes stress and allows you to enjoy the celebration.
